About the Business

Heritage Nature Trail is a sprawling park and tourist attraction located at 2506 North Boulevard in Cadillac, Michigan, United States. This enchanting destination offers visitors a chance to explore the natural beauty and rich history of the area through a series of well-maintained trails and scenic overlooks. Whether you're looking to immerse yourself in the serene surroundings or learn more about the local heritage, Heritage Nature Trail is the perfect place to unwind and reconnect with nature. Dale Rice:
5

"This was a beautiful short hike. The trails are well marked and there are several nice rest benches. Very flat terrain and easy to navigate."

Marcos Pereira:
5

"Great trail for a 1 hour walk. Clean, with maps throughout trail. Many birds, turtles, flowers and nice views. Park staff make patrols regularly on bikes. Some parking at beginning of the trail"

David Borger Germann:
4

"Nice, easy trail. Not a lot of shade, however, so if it's sunny and warm, it will get hot. (There's shade for the first ~1/4 mile and then very little.) Plenty of bugs too, including biting flies. Several types of warblers, singing their hearts out in midsummer."

Eli Tennant:
5

"This is one of the most beautiful trails I have been to in Michigan. I hiked it at the beginning of April so there was still snow and no bugs. The trails were well marked, although I think the map is not quite the scale. After hiking out to the main loop, you will have the beautiful scenery of small ponds, streams, and marshes on both sides of you for the entirety of the loop. They also have several boardwalks and bridges which are in fairly good condition. Enjoy your hike!"
